two.1.4) Short description

The contracts are for the provision of GP Out of Hours for Scarborough, Ryedale, and Vale of York, as well as Urgent Treatment Centres for York and Scarborough , for and on behalf of NHS Vale of York CCG and NHS North Yorkshire CCG.

two.2.4) Description of the procurement

18 month contract for the provision of GP Out of Hours for Scarborough, Ryedale, and Vale of York, as well as Urgent Treatment Centres for York and Scarborough, commencing on 01 April 2022.

Section six. Complementary information

six.3) Additional information

NHS Vale of York Clinical Commissioning Group and NHS North Yorkshire Clinical Commissioning Group intend to enter into a contract with Vocare Ltd for the delivery of GP Out of Hours for Scarborough, Ryedale, and Vale of York, as well as Urgent Treatment Centres for York and Scarborough, upon completion of a 10 day voluntary standstill period which will commence on the date of the publication of this notice and conclude midnight on 21 March 2022.

It is intended that commissioning of future services will be undertaken in line with relevant legislation.
